#if !UNITY_2018_3_OR_NEWER
|
|
using System;
|
|
using System.IO;
|
|
using UnityEditor;
|
|
using UnityEditor.Callbacks;
|
|
using UnityEngine;
|
|
|
|
namespace Google.Android.AppBundle.Editor.Internal.BuildTools
|
|
{
|
|
/// <summary>
|
|
/// Runs a task after a player build causes the application domain to reset and scripts to be reloaded.
|
|
/// Starting with Unity 2018.3 player builds no longer reset the application domain.
|
|
/// </summary>
|
|
public static class PostBuildRunner
|
|
{
|
|
/// <summary>
|
|
/// Class that provides an abstraction layer above <see cref="PostBuildTask"/> in order to capture
|
|
/// the task's full type name, which is needed for task deserialization.
|
|
/// </summary>
|
|
[Serializable]
|
|
private class TaskConfig
|
|
{
|
|
/// <summary>
|
|
/// Location of the <see cref="PostBuildTask"/> serialized file.
|
|
/// </summary>
|
|
public string taskFilePath;
|
|
|
|
/// <summary>
|
|
/// The full type name of the class that was serialized at <see cref="taskFilePath"/>.
|
|
/// </summary>
|
|
public string taskTypeName;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
private static readonly string PostBuildTaskConfigFilePath =
|
|
Path.Combine("Library", "PlayPostBuildTaskConfig.json");
|
|
|
|
private static float _progress;
|
|
|
|
/// <summary>
|
|
/// Serializes the specified task to disk for running after scripts are reloaded.
|
|
/// </summary>
|
|
public static void RunTask(PostBuildTask task)
|
|
{
|
|
if (File.Exists(PostBuildTaskConfigFilePath))
|
|
{
|
|
Debug.LogWarningFormat(
|
|
"Creating a new post-build task when one already exists: {0}", PostBuildTaskConfigFilePath);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
var taskFilePath = Path.Combine(Path.GetTempPath(), Path.GetRandomFileName());
|
|
var taskConfig = new TaskConfig {taskFilePath = taskFilePath, taskTypeName = task.GetType().FullName};
|
|
|
|
SerializeToJson(taskFilePath, task);
|
|
SerializeToJson(PostBuildTaskConfigFilePath, taskConfig);
|
|
|
|
_progress = 0.0f;
|
|
// We don't unsubscribe from updates (except when canceling) because script reload will reset everything.
|
|
EditorApplication.update += HandleUpdate;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
[DidReloadScripts]
|
|
private static void DidReloadScripts()
|
|
{
|
|
if (!File.Exists(PostBuildTaskConfigFilePath))
|
|
{
|
|
// In the common case the scripts reloaded because of a script change, etc. Nothing to do.
|
|
return;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
PostBuildTask postBuildTask;
|
|
try
|
|
{
|
|
// Hide the progress bar that was shown in HandleUpdate().
|
|
EditorUtility.ClearProgressBar();
|
|
|
|
Debug.LogFormat("Loading post-build task config file: {0}", PostBuildTaskConfigFilePath);
|
|
var taskConfigJsonText = File.ReadAllText(PostBuildTaskConfigFilePath);
|
|
var taskConfig = JsonUtility.FromJson<TaskConfig>(taskConfigJsonText);
|
|
var taskJsonText = File.ReadAllText(taskConfig.taskFilePath);
|
|
var taskTypeName = taskConfig.taskTypeName;
|
|
|
|
Debug.LogFormat("Loading and running post-build task for type: {0}", taskTypeName);
|
|
var postBuildTaskObj = JsonUtility.FromJson(taskJsonText, Type.GetType(taskTypeName));
|
|
postBuildTask = (PostBuildTask) postBuildTaskObj;
|
|
}
|
|
finally
|
|
{
|
|
// Remove the config file so that this task doesn't run again after the next application domain reset.
|
|
File.Delete(PostBuildTaskConfigFilePath);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
postBuildTask.RunPostBuildTask();
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
// Handler for EditorApplication.update callbacks.
|
|
private static void HandleUpdate()
|
|
{
|
|
// Magic number to partially fill up the progress bar during the time that it takes scripts to reload.
|
|
// Note that the best number varies by version, but better to finish with the progress bar less than
|
|
// full on some versions than full long before scripts reload on other versions.
|
|
_progress += 0.0005f;
|
|
|
|
if (!EditorUtility.DisplayCancelableProgressBar("Waiting for scripts to reload...", null, _progress))
|
|
{
|
|
return;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
Debug.Log("Canceling post-build task before scripts reload...");
|
|
// Since the existence of the config file is the signal to run a post-build task, delete the file to cancel.
|
|
File.Delete(PostBuildTaskConfigFilePath);
|
|
EditorUtility.ClearProgressBar();
|
|
EditorApplication.update -= HandleUpdate;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
private static void SerializeToJson(string path, object obj)
|
|
{
|
|
var jsonText = JsonUtility.ToJson(obj);
|
|
File.WriteAllText(path, jsonText);
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
#endif |
